#f8bfe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f8bfe2 is composed of 97.3% red, 74.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 8.9%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 323.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 86.1%. #f8bfe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f17fc5.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f8bfe2 color description : Very soft pink.
#f8bfe2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f8bfe2 has RGB values of R:248, G:191,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.09,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16302050.

Shades and Tints of #f8bfe2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fef4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8bfe2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dddadc is the less saturated color, while #fdbae3 is the most saturated one.
